Objective Assessment of Technical Skills in Cardiothoracic Surgery

Completed

Conditions studied: Other Surgical Procedures

In brief

The goal of this research study is to develop a method of rating videos of CAB procedures that will produce a reliable assessment of a cardiothoracic surgical trainee's technical proficiency. In addition, researchers also want to learn if using a video manual to train raters can help improve rater reliability.
